Sozialhelden. (2011). Wheelmap (Version 4.1.70) [Mobile application software]. Retrieved from https://apps.apple.com/us/app/wheelmap/id399239476
Price: Free
Rubric Score: 5/11 (used only the technical and user experience criteria from the Haines Rubric)
Age and intended audience: 4+, For anyone who is mobility impaired
Review: Wheelmap is an online map designed to provide information on wheelchair accessible places for the mobility impaired community. In the same vein as a Google map, users can enter a city or specific address and see wheelchair accessible places in and around that address. Users experience ease when using the app with wheelchair accessible locations being color coded on the map with green (fully wheelchair accessible), yellow (partially wheelchair accessible), and red (not wheelchair accessible) indicators. The app is not the most intuitive and tends to be difficult to maneuver. Wheelmap allows users to contribute information about destinations to expand information about wheelchair accessibility to the greatest degree. However, there is still much information that is missing from the app about most locations, even in large cities where the foot traffic would be heavier. iTunes recommends usage for those aged 4+. Wheelmap does not offer any creativity for a child user and would best be used as a tool for a parent or caregiver scoping out wheelchair accessible destinations for those who are mobility impaired in their parties.
